Your opponent’s Active Pokémon is now Confused. Put 6 damage counters instead of 3 on that Pokémon for this Special Condition.
Aromatisse
Its scent is so overpowering that, unless a Trainer happens to really enjoy the smell, he or she will have a hard time walking alongside it.
| Supertype | Pokémon |
|---|---|
| Subtype | Stage 1 |
| HP | 90 |
| Types | Fairy |
| Attack | Heavy Perfume |
| Attack cost | Fairy |
| Artist | Mizue |
| Rarity | Rare |
| Pokédex | 683 |
| Evolves from | Spritzee |
